Job description

To decarbonize the industrial sector, cost-effective solutions integrating renewable energy sources and energy storage are necessary. Moreover, most of the industries characterize for having large and variable heat requirements in their production processes, and so optimized thermal processes and technologies are paramount for their decarbonization, including for example heat pumps, electric heaters, thermal energy storage, and heat exchangers. The present work will focus on the design optimization, prototyping and testing of new thermal technologies, and more specifically in advanced compact and high-performance heat exchangers. Manufacturability, scalability, circularity, reliability, serviceability, seamless integration and costs shall be in scope in the design of these optimum new heat exchangers. In doing so, investigations will consider the use of additive manufacturing and selection of best materials also depending on the process requirements in terms of pressure, temperatures and thermal fluids involved. Cooperation with industrial partners in international projects is expected, including e.g. heat pumping, thermal energy storage and electric heater suppliers. Candidates shall have proven background and interest in heat transfer, thermodynamics, computational fluid dynamics and finite elements methods.
